FAQ: Parity between Lumekit JS and Lumekit Go SDKs

Q: Are the two SDKs at feature parity?
A: No. Lumekit Go lags on streaming uploads and retry hooks. Batch endpoints match. Don't promise parity to clients. Parity tracker lives in the internal board; check before quoting timelines. Webhook signing differs in naming only. For access to the parity tracker workspace, enter the recovery passphrase printed below.

unlock words, hahip-baduf: holwyn-istath-julvan

Handover: BranchSweep bot — from Odel to Renna

BranchSweep runs nightly, flags branches idle past 60 days, and deletes after a 14-day warning. Config is in `sweep.toml`; the allowlist covers release branches. Dry-run mode is the default on fresh deploys. The bot's credential vault relocks if the host reboots, and unlocking it requires the recovery passphrase, which is noted just below:

strongbox words: fenwyn-lamix-novael-holeth-sorix-druael-lamwyn

**CI note: timezone weirdness in report exports**

Heads up, support folks — if a customer says their Ledgerpine export shows times shifted by a few hours, it's probably the CI image. The export workers got rebuilt last week and the base image defaults to UTC, while older workers used the account's locale. Fix is rolling out; meanwhile tell customers the data itself is fine, just the display offset. Affected exports carry the build token shown below.

build token for bajof-tahop: htk4_a981